How Does the iPhone Digicam App Create a Blurred Background?

The bokeh created by your iPhone could be very convincing, however do you know that Portrait Mode doesn’t technically create “actual” bokeh?

Bokeh refers back to the nice visible qualities created within the out-of-focus areas of a picture. While you’ve obtained your topic in sharp focus, that nice swirling of sunshine behind them is the bokeh.

The technical particulars of bokeh are thrilling and contain how totally different apertures and lenses produce Circles of Confusion in your digicam’s movie or sensor. Issues are just a little totally different in your iPhone.  

The iPhone’s Portrait Mode makes use of each rear dealing with lenses to take two simultaneous photos. It then analyzes each pictures to create one thing referred to as a “disparity map.” 

The pictures taken by each cameras are almost an identical, however are barely off heart from one another. That is just like if you give attention to an object after which alternate which eye is open and which is closed. 

Objects which are additional other than their near-copy should be nearer to your digicam. The iPhone’s software program then applies a blur impact to features of the picture which are too shut collectively. This fashion, your topic stays in focus whereas your background blurs.

How Do You Blur the Background on iPhones With out Portrait Mode?

You probably have an iPhone that’s older than mannequin 7, you’re not going to have the ability to use portrait mode. Fashions of iPhone that additionally solely have one digicam on the again solely have restricted entry to the options out there on this mode.

See also  65 Finest Images Books for Inexperienced persons in 2023

However don’t fear. There are nonetheless some methods you can seize bokeh in your iPhone. 

Get Nearer to Your Topic

Each digicam lens is technically able to producing bokeh. The lenses in your iPhone are undoubtedly going to have the ability to naturally generate easy bokeh, you’re simply going to must get so much nearer to your topic.

This won’t work for each portrait or each shot. Getting bodily nearer implies that you’re going to must reframe your composition and which may not provide the outcomes that you just’re searching for.

As a common rule, I choose to go for the naturally occurring bokeh every time attainable. For my part, the outcomes at all times look just a little bit extra natural after they’re developed in digicam. 

Use Macro Mode

Macro Mode is offered on iPhone 13 and later. Macro Mode is designed for taking extraordinarily shut up photos of your topics, nevertheless it will also be used to blur the background of all kinds of photographs. 

Add a Lens to Your Smartphone 

The lenses on the again of your smartphone bias in the direction of vast angle taking pictures. Because of this they’re nice for common images, however they’re much less ultimate in terms of isolating a topic from its background.

Including a further lens to your iPhone may also help increase the focal size and permit you to isolate your topics rather more successfully. I like to recommend selecting up a cell lens just like the Second Telephoto Lens in case you’re trying to take extra smartphone portraits.

How Do I Flip a Common Image into Portrait Mode?

There’s at the moment no strategy to instantly convert your common picture right into a portrait mode picture inside the Apple Images app. 

Portrait mode takes a specialised picture utilizing two of the lenses on the again of your iPhone. Different modes solely use one lens.

Because of this images taken exterior of portrait mode merely lack the digital data essential to convert them right into a “portrait mode” {photograph}.

Troubleshooting Background Blur: Why received’t my iPhone do Portrait mode?

Getting portrait mode to work correctly isn’t at all times as easy because it may appear.

I’ve obtained seven bug fixes that can assist you get issues again up and operating if portrait mode isn’t working proper.

  1. You’re Too Shut—When you’re too near your topic, portrait mode won’t be able to work correctly. Your iPhone will even provide you with just a little pop-up warning saying that you should transfer additional away. 
  2. You’re Too Far—Likewise, in case you’re too far-off out of your topic portrait mode will acknowledge it as a part of the background relatively than as the thing you’re trying to spotlight. 
  3. Shoot a Human Topic—iPhone fashions with a single rear digicam are unable to do portrait mode on something apart from human topics. When you solely have one digicam lens on the again of your telephone, attempt taking a portrait of an individual relatively than an object or a pet. 
  4. Enhance Your Lighting—The portrait mode setting on iPhone can wrestle in low gentle or extraordinarily shiny circumstances. You’ll get the most effective outcomes out of this app when taking pictures a mean lighting. 
  5. Keep away from Crowds—Crowds of individuals are likely to confuse the software program that runs portrait mode. Keep away from taking photos of your topic with a crowd behind them as a way to restrict the quantity of faces the app has to detect. 
  6. Alter Your Aperture—Within the higher proper of portrait mode you’ll see a small button with the letter “f.” This lets you open up a slider to pick your aperture with a decrease aperture creating extra blur than a better aperture. 
  7. Replace Your Cellphone—Portrait mode is a part of your iPhone’s digicam and which means it’s simply as vulnerable to bugs and glitches as the remainder of your telephone. Resetting and updating your telephone may filter any issues which are inflicting points with portrait mode.
